US Bank Presents the Champ Car Grand Prix of Cleveland
Round 5 of 16




Michel Jourdain, #9


Qualified 13th     59.448/127.533 mph




Michel Jourdain


"We're still struggling with the rear of the car which is especially bad over the new pavement on the back
straight.  I'm confident that the Gigante crew will find a solution.  It's the biggest obstacle at the moment, so
fixing that should make a big difference in our times."



Jeremy Dale, Team President


"We're obviously not where we want to be which has a lot to do with this track and how distinctive it is.  We just
haven't given him the package he needs to go out and be quick.  So, Michel doesn't have a whole lot of
confidence in the car right now.  We'll go to work tonight to give him a better car for tomorrow."
